They finally posted something on their forum:
We have noticed series of fairly large DDOS attacks during last 4 days. Some of them have caused increased latency and there was one that have caused 15 minute downtime for some customers around 4AM earlier today.
Our staff is standing by, monitoring the network to filter any new attacks as quickly as possible.
thank you
FDCservers
The sad part is that it took them 4 days to actually tell the customers what was going on.
